Sažetak

Vaccination is considered one of the potential tools to reduce antibiotic use in dairy herds by preventing mastitis. This study compared milk yield (2024) and milk quality (June 2022–2024) in two groups of Holstein herds in the Bohemian-Moravian Highlands (the Czech Republic): eight vaccinated herds and eight unvaccinated herds. The groups were comparable in days in milk, calving interval, and altitude. A periodic intradermal autogenous vaccine targeted gram-negative pathogens. Milk yield was slightly higher in unvaccinated herds (vaccinated vs. unvaccinated: 1st lactation 10,372 ± 935 vs. 10,503 ± 2,139 kg; later lactations 11,510 ± 1,270 vs. 11,780 ± 2,491 kg). The somatic cell count (187 ± 71 vs. 178 ± 47 10³/ml; P<0.001) and the total count of mesophilic microorganisms (TCM; 23.1 ± 68.4 vs. 15.0 ± 41.5 10³ CFU/ml; P<0.01) were slightly higher in vaccinated herds. The count of coliform bacteria (COLI) was 9.7 ± 24.1 vs. 17.3 ± 34.7 CFU/ml (P>0.05), which may indicate the vaccine’s focus on gram-negative pathogens. To assess longer-term trends, bulk tank milk samples from the pre-vaccination period (2021–May 2022) were also included. Comparison of pre- and post-vaccination periods showed observable improvements over time in vaccinated herds, more notably increased fat (2.9%), lactose (0.61%), and solids-not-fat (0.56%), and reduced free fatty acids (–3.23%), TCM (–9.09%, based on geometric means), and COLI (–60%, based on geometric means). Overall, vaccination was associated with slight improvements in several milk quality indicators, which tended to move closer to those observed in unvaccinated herds.
